Curatorial context
From 16 December 2017 to 11 March 2018, Eye Filmmuseum hosted an exhibition for Danish artist Jesper Just. Known for his cinematographic works that delve into gender, desires, relations, and identity through a refined visual idiom, Just's exhibition at Eye focused on his large spatial film installations. The artist skillfully transforms film into an architectural intervention within the museum space, often utilizing extreme dimensions like 25-meter-wide projections across multiple screens. These immersive presentations are complemented by complex sound and light installations, and sometimes significant alterations to the existing architecture.
Just, who works internationally, employs a sophisticated cinematic language reminiscent of major motion picture productions, including meticulous lighting, dynamic perspective shifts, and flowing camera movements. However, he utilizes these techniques not for traditional feature films, but to create powerful film installations. These works present disconcerting and sometimes unsettling situations, encouraging viewers to engage with their own vicarious emotions. Eye's interest in Just stems from his innovative approach to spatial film presentation, aligning with the museum's mission to showcase film beyond conventional screening formats and explore its intersection with visual art.

Artist line / attribution
Featuring the work of Jesper Just, curated by Jaap Guldemond in collaboration with Marente Bloemheuvel.
